LOS ANGELES, March 22 — More than 500,000 children were shut out of lessons Tuesday as school workers in Los Angeles began a three-day walkout over pay.
Service Employees International Union Local 99 says many of its members earn as little as US$25,000 per year. Los Angeles is one of America’s most pricey places to live, with high taxes and expensive grocery and utility bills.LAUSD officials said they have offered a 23 per cent increase, along with a three per cent “cash-in-hand bonus”.
